Best overall PvE Build?

in Guardian

Posted by: Korval.3751

Korval.3751

Because Right Hand Strength is probably one of the best grandmaster traits in the game and you will probably be using a scepter or mace at least some of the time, and that alone makes it worthwhile.

The only weapon that puts out the highest, consistent (consistency is really important) DPS for Guardians is Greatsword. Everything else is either healing or a flavor preference.

The mace is a weapon for healing and protection. Using the trait Valor > VII Mace of Justice grants 5% additional damage and up to 250 healing power while wielding a mace. Besides the trait you have these mace skills:

  1. Faithful Strike (chain 3) – Hit your foe with a final strike and heal nearby allies.
  2. Symbol of Faith – Smash a mystic symbol onto the ground that damages foes and regenerates allies.
  3. Protector’s Strike – Surround yourself and nearby allies with a shield. Damage foes that strike protected allies. Grant protection to yourself and nearby allies if you are not struck.

Needless to say every skill on a mace for Guardians is meant for healing and protection. A Greatsword has none of these type of skills. It’s pure DPS. If someone was keen on going with a one handed weapon for DPS then I guess a better solution would be sword. But I still feel Greatsword is the best for straight DPS.

This is my build:

http://gw2buildcraft.com/calculator/guardian/?3.4|1.1g.h1b|b.1g.a7.d.1g.h1j|1g.71h.1g.71h.1g.71g.1g.71g.1g.77.1g.77|4s.d1e.2s.d1e.3s.d1e.2s.d1e.3s.d1e.cc.67|0.a6.u56b.u28b.0|1.9|v.16.19.18.1i|e

I’m doing CoF P1 and P2 ( i know, they don’t count much ) and FoTM (currently in lvl 19)

But, idk, i’m feeling kinda useless or too weak. This is because of two things i think:

1 – I have a ridiculous low health. With one shot from a boss in FoTM (the dredge champion) i get downed. I don’t know if everyone gets one shoted by this boss, this is normal? Also, normal mobs with 4 hits almost kill me.

It’s not so much your health. With my DPS build my health is 13,885.

What you lack is raw DPS. That calculator doesn’t list your Attack only Power (which is 1,992). My character’s unbuffed Power is 2,186 and Attack 3,286. Based on that your Attack is probably around 2,800. For FOTM you really want to be at or above 3k. If you can push it up to and past 3,200 then you’ll be sitting good.

The other thing I noticed is your build is virtually balanced between Power and Precision meaning your ranged DPS is about the same as your melee DPS. If you want to do lots of melee damage then you need to sacrifice and lower your Precision.

Feel free to check out my DPS build. It should help push you over 3,200 Attack.

Make FOTM level and AR account stats

in Suggestions

Posted by: Korval.3751

Korval.3751

I agree with the latest blog article about Magic Find. It did not make sense to have a separate set of gear with MF only or to sacrifice gear stats for MF. Great move Arenanet! In the same vein I think FOTM levels and Agony Resistance should also become an account stat and here’s why.

For the sake of example I have an 80 Guardian and 80 Necromancer. Both characters have exotic gear. Guardian carries a legendary; Necromancer does not. More FOTM runs were done with Guardian than Necromancer. Guardian is FOTM level 24 and has 20 agony resistance. My Necromancer is FOTM 3 and has 0 AR.

Now let’s say I am getting bored with Guardian. I would like to freshen things up and play Necromancer for a few weeks. The way FOTM works I cannot continue my progression at FOTM 24. I have start at FOTM 3 to level up, and since my Necromancer has no AR FOTM ~15-19 is likely the safest.

Do you see the problem?

I understand grinding is a major aspect of any game. Even single player games have grinding. I understand that. I define grind as being forced to do something that I’ve already done in order to reach a level or achievement I’ve already reached. If my Guardian is FOTM24 with AR20 then it seems reasonable that my Necromancer should also be FOTM24 with AR20. Which class I play in the current FOTM level should be my choice.

But “You won’t play well with your Necromancer in those harder fractals” you might say. You could be right but at the same time I will know immediately if I need to reschool myself on playing a Necromancer. Keep in mind you should not doubt a player’s level of knowledge even if they switch characters. Most players can play more than one class very well. Deciding which class to progress in FOTM should be decided by the players and not arbitrary rules.

The level of FOTM and agony resistance should become unlockable attributes for the entire account in the same way Hall of Monument and achievement rewards work.

Does this seem like a reasonable request?

Unlockable Elite skills, GW1 style

in Suggestions

Posted by: Korval.3751

Korval.3751

As a veteran Guild Wars 1 player (I still play) one of the things I love most about the game is the way you acquire elite skills! I LOVE THE TIME and in some cases difficulty! The process is involved. I have to buy a Signet of Capture for each elite skill I want for 1 platnum each. I then have to track down the mob, which is made easy with the official GW1 wiki. Finally I have to defeat the mob (who is generally surrounded by other mobs). After the target mob is dead I use Signet of Capture. I now have a brand new elite skill for my hybrid class!

With the announcement of New Skill and Traits I would like to propose bringing the way elite skills are acquired from GW1 into GW2. In a persistent environment the mechanic would have to be different for obvious reasons. Here’s how this could happen.

1. Visit a certain NPC to start an elite skill quest. These NPCs would be scattered all over Tyria and depending on the rarity or difficulty of the elite skill they would be placed in easy to reach places (Queensdale, Wayfarer Foothills, etc), medium to reach places (Malchor’s Leap, Frostgorge Sound, etc) and hard to reach places (Honor of the Waves, Arah, etc).

2. The NPC will give you a mission to complete some sort of objective (destroy, courier, escort, explorer, a mix of these or perhaps a brand new type). The objective would probably be a certain NPC. Think guild bounties.

3. Targets will always be found in either special instances or they may be instanced themselves to where only you and your group mates can see and interactive with them. You can bring your friends along if you would like help getting these elite skill quests done. Targets inside dungeons would always require groups.

4. After the mission is complete return to the NPC quest giver and you’ll be rewarded with a brand new ELITE skill… and perhaps some karma and coin for your troubles too!

And if for some reason players don’t want to trouble themselves to go get these elite skills they could buy elite skill packs from the gemstore. 5 Randoms Elite Skills for 400G. “Guaranteed not to contain duplicates.”

Does this sound like a good suggestion?

Will Anet EVER make arah 1 player?

in Personal Story

Posted by: Korval.3751

Korval.3751

What about a difficulty scale? Single player games have offered this for decades, it allow people to see the story and for those who want more a challenge they can increase the difficulty. I’ve never understood why MMO developers don’t look to this.

It’s interesting you offer that suggestion because there is a difficulty scale in place for events. I’ve seen it happen. For example in Queensdale there’s the Beetletun escort event. I have done this event by myself. When the Centaurs show up there’s only 3-4 at most, however when I did the same event hours later with groups of players there were LOTS more Centaurs.

This same principle should be applied to Arah’s story mode. If one player would like to do the “dungeon” then the difficult should scale down to support one player. And if a group of friends would like to do Arah the difficulty should scale up to support more than one.
